From 3da5cf0277ed8770a0b0f99721c4dafec72523df Mon Sep 17 00:00:00 2001
From: lbq <1065079612@qq.com>
Date: 星期五, 23 一月 2026 14:10:48 +0800
Subject: [PATCH] order字段顺序优化

---
 rsf-admin/src/page/waitPakin/WaitPakinItemList.jsx               |    4 ++--
 rsf-admin/src/page/orders/asnOrder/AsnOrderItemList.jsx          |   10 ++++++----
 rsf-admin/src/page/waitPakin/WaitPakinEdit.jsx                   |    5 ++---
 rsf-admin/src/i18n/zh.js                                         |    8 ++++----
 rsf-admin/src/page/warehouseAreasItem/WarehouseAreasItemList.jsx |   25 ++++++++++++++-----------
 5 files changed, 28 insertions(+), 24 deletions(-)

diff --git a/rsf-admin/src/i18n/zh.js b/rsf-admin/src/i18n/zh.js
index 1b7cc97..67286e3 100644
--- a/rsf-admin/src/i18n/zh.js
+++ b/rsf-admin/src/i18n/zh.js
@@ -473,12 +473,12 @@
                 matnrCode: "鐗╂枡缂栫爜",
                 fieldsIndex: "鎵╁睍瀛楁鍞竴鏍囪瘑",
                 workQty: '涓婃灦涓�',
-                qty: '宸插畬鎴�',
+                qty: '瀹炴敹鏁伴噺',
                 barcode: "鏉″舰鐮�",
                 isptResult: '璐ㄦ鐘舵��',
-                anfme: "鏁伴噺",
-                batch: "鎵规鍙�",
-                unit: "璁¢噺鍗曚綅",
+                anfme: "搴旀敹鏁伴噺",
+                batch: "鎵规",
+                unit: "鍗曚綅",
                 stockUnit: "搴撳瓨鍗曚綅",
                 brand: "鍝佺墝",
                 shipperId: "璐т富鏍囪瘑",
diff --git a/rsf-admin/src/page/orders/asnOrder/AsnOrderItemList.jsx b/rsf-admin/src/page/orders/asnOrder/AsnOrderItemList.jsx
index 9b65ac7..7062e5c 100644
--- a/rsf-admin/src/page/orders/asnOrder/AsnOrderItemList.jsx
+++ b/rsf-admin/src/page/orders/asnOrder/AsnOrderItemList.jsx
@@ -164,7 +164,7 @@
 
 const DynamicFields = (props) => {
   const translate = useTranslate();
-  const notify = useNotify();
+  const notify = useNotify(); 
   const [columns, setColumns] = useState([]);
   const { isLoading } = useListContext();
   const refresh = useRefresh();
@@ -180,13 +180,14 @@
               'businessTime', 'extendFields.[businessTime]',
               'wkType', 'extendFields.[wkType]',
               'type', 'extendFields.[type]',
-              'priceUnitId',
+              'priceUnitId', 'purUnit', 'extendFields.[priceUnitId]',
               'id', 'orderId', 'orderCode', 'poCode', 'poId','wkType', 
               'type', 'checkType', 'spec', 'model', 'purQty', 'purUnit', 
               'qrcode', 'trackCode', 'splrCode', 'splrName', 'projectCode', 
               'supplierId', 'supplierName',  'shipperId',
-              'updateTime', 'updateBy', 'updateBy$',
+              // 'updateTime', 'updateBy', 'updateBy$',
               'createTime', 'createBy', 'createBy$',
+              'extendFields.[inStockType]', 'extendFields.[baseUnitId]'
           ];
           const columns = result.columns.filter(col => !hiddenSources.includes(col.props.source));
           setColumns(columns);
@@ -222,7 +223,8 @@
           preferenceKey='asnOrderItem'
           bulkActionButtons={false}
           rowClick={(id, resource, record) => false}
-          omit={['id', 'orderId', 'orderCode', 'poCode', 'poId', 'wkType', 'type', 'checkType', 'spec', 'model', 'purQty', 'purUnit', 'qrcode', 'trackCode', 'splrCode', 'splrName', 'projectCode', 'supplierId', 'supplierName', 'priceUnitId', 'shipperId', 'businessTime', 'extendFields.[businessTime]', 'extendFields.[wkType]', 'extendFields.[type]']}
+          omit={['id', 'orderId', 'orderCode', 'poCode', 'poId', 'wkType', 'type', 'checkType', 'spec', 'model', 'purQty', 'purUnit', 'qrcode', 'trackCode', 'splrCode', 
+            'splrName', 'projectCode', 'supplierId', 'supplierName', 'priceUnitId', 'shipperId', 'businessTime', 'extendFields.[businessTime]', 'extendFields.[wkType]', 'extendFields.[type]']}
         >
           {columns.map((column) => column)}
         </StyledDatagrid>}
diff --git a/rsf-admin/src/page/waitPakin/WaitPakinEdit.jsx b/rsf-admin/src/page/waitPakin/WaitPakinEdit.jsx
index b6f182e..d74a5eb 100644
--- a/rsf-admin/src/page/waitPakin/WaitPakinEdit.jsx
+++ b/rsf-admin/src/page/waitPakin/WaitPakinEdit.jsx
@@ -71,7 +71,7 @@
                                     parse={v => v}
                                     autoFocus
                                 />
-                                <SelectInput
+                                {/* <SelectInput
                                     label="table.field.waitPakin.flagDefect"
                                     readOnly
                                     source="flagDefect"
@@ -79,8 +79,7 @@
                                         { id: 0, name: '鍚�' },
                                         { id: 1, name: ' 鏄�' },
                                     ]}
-                                />
-
+                                /> */}
                                 <TextInput
                                     label="table.field.waitPakin.barcode"
                                     readOnly
diff --git a/rsf-admin/src/page/waitPakin/WaitPakinItemList.jsx b/rsf-admin/src/page/waitPakin/WaitPakinItemList.jsx
index 6e99dac..8561354 100644
--- a/rsf-admin/src/page/waitPakin/WaitPakinItemList.jsx
+++ b/rsf-admin/src/page/waitPakin/WaitPakinItemList.jsx
@@ -157,6 +157,7 @@
             const arr = [
                 <NumberField source="id" />,
                 <NumberField source="pakinId" label="table.field.waitPakinItem.pakinId" />,
+                <TextField source="platWorkCode" label="table.field.asnOrderItem.platWorkCode" />,
                 <TextField source="matnrCode" label="table.field.waitPakinItem.matnrCode" />,
                 <TextField source="maktx" label="table.field.waitPakinItem.maktx" />,
                 <TextField source="batch" label="table.field.waitPakinItem.batch" />,
@@ -164,7 +165,6 @@
                 <NumberField source="anfme" label="table.field.waitPakinItem.anfme" />,
                 <TextField source="unit" label="table.field.waitPakinItem.unit" />,
                 <TextField source="platOrderCode" label="table.field.asnOrderItem.platOrderCode" />,
-                <TextField source="platWorkCode" label="table.field.asnOrderItem.platWorkCode" />,
                 <TextField source="projectCode" label="table.field.asnOrderItem.projectCode" />,
                 <NumberField source="workQty" label="table.field.waitPakinItem.workQty" />,
                 <NumberField source="qty" label="table.field.waitPakinItem.qty" />,
@@ -203,7 +203,7 @@
                     preferenceKey='waitPakinItem'
                     bulkActionButtons={false}
                     rowClick={(id, resource, record) => false}
-                    omit={['id', 'pakinId', 'createTime', 'matnrId', 'createBy', 'memo', 'fieldsIndex', 'platWorkCode', 'projectCode']}
+                    omit={['id', 'pakinId', 'createTime', 'matnrId', 'createBy', 'memo', 'fieldsIndex',  'projectCode']}    //'platWorkCode',
                 >
                     {columns.map((column) => column)}
                 </StyledDatagrid>}
diff --git a/rsf-admin/src/page/warehouseAreasItem/WarehouseAreasItemList.jsx b/rsf-admin/src/page/warehouseAreasItem/WarehouseAreasItemList.jsx
index 60d1b75..bb89f92 100644
--- a/rsf-admin/src/page/warehouseAreasItem/WarehouseAreasItemList.jsx
+++ b/rsf-admin/src/page/warehouseAreasItem/WarehouseAreasItemList.jsx
@@ -179,18 +179,21 @@
         if (code == 200) {
             const arr = [
                 <NumberField key="id" source="id" />,
+                // <NumberField key="areaId" source="areaId" label="table.field.warehouseAreasItem.areaId" />,
+                <TextField key="areaName" source="areaName" label="鏀惰揣鍖哄悕绉�" />,    //table.field.warehouseAreasItem.areaName
                 <TextField key="asnCode" source="asnCode" label="table.field.warehouseAreasItem.asnCode" />,
-                <NumberField key="areaId" source="areaId" label="table.field.warehouseAreasItem.areaId" />,
-                <TextField key="areaName" source="areaName" label="table.field.warehouseAreasItem.areaName" />,
+                <TextField source="platWorkCode" label="table.field.asnOrderItem.platWorkCode" />, 
+                <TextField source="platItemId" label="table.field.deliveryItem.platItemId" />, 
                 <NumberField key="matnrId" source="matnrId" label="table.field.warehouseAreasItem.matnrId" />,
-                <TextField key="maktx" source="maktx" label="table.field.warehouseAreasItem.matnrName" />,
                 <TextField key="matnrCode" source="matnrCode" label="table.field.warehouseAreasItem.matnrCode" />,
+                <TextField key="maktx" source="maktx" label="table.field.warehouseAreasItem.matnrName" />,
+                <TextField key="splrBatch" source="splrBatch" label="table.field.warehouseAreasItem.splrBtch" />,
+                <TextField key="batch" source="batch" label="table.field.warehouseAreasItem.batch" />,
                 <TextField key="trackCode" source="trackCode" label="table.field.warehouseAreasItem.barcode" />,
                 <NumberField key="anfme" source="anfme" label="table.field.warehouseAreasItem.anfme" />,
                 <NumberField key="workQty" source="workQty" label="table.field.warehouseAreasItem.workQty" />,
                 <NumberField key="qty" source="qty" label="table.field.warehouseAreasItem.qty" />,
-                <TextField source="platOrderCode" label="table.field.asnOrderItem.platOrderCode" />,
-                <TextField source="platWorkCode" label="table.field.asnOrderItem.platWorkCode" />,
+                <TextField source="platOrderCode" label="table.field.asnOrderItem.platOrderCode" />,                
                 <TextField source="projectCode" label="table.field.asnOrderItem.projectCode" />,
                 // <MyField source="isptQty" label="table.field.qlyIsptItem.anfme"
                 //     onClick={(event, record, val) => {
@@ -199,10 +202,9 @@
                 //         setDrawerVal(!!drawerVal && drawerVal === val ? null : val);
                 //     }}
                 // />,
-                <TextField key="splrBatch" source="splrBatch" label="table.field.warehouseAreasItem.splrBtch" />,
-                <TextField key="batch" source="batch" label="table.field.warehouseAreasItem.batch" />,
+                                
                 <TextField key="unit" source="unit" label="table.field.warehouseAreasItem.unit" />,
-                <TextField key="stockUnit" source="stockUnit" label="table.field.warehouseAreasItem.stockUnit" />,
+                // <TextField key="stockUnit" source="stockUnit" label="table.field.warehouseAreasItem.stockUnit" />,
                 <TextField key="brand" source="brand" label="table.field.warehouseAreasItem.brand" />,
                 <TextField key="shipperId" source="shipperId" label="table.field.warehouseAreasItem.shipperId" />,
                 <TextField key="splrId" source="splrId" label="table.field.warehouseAreasItem.splrId" />,
@@ -212,8 +214,8 @@
             ]
             const fields = data.map(el => <TextField key={el.fields} source={`extendFields.[${el.fields}]`} label={el.fieldsAlise} />)
             const lastArr = [
-                <TextField key="updateBy" source="updateBy$" label="common.field.updateBy" />,
                 <DateField key="updateTime" source="updateTime" label="common.field.updateTime" showTime />,
+                <TextField key="updateBy" source="updateBy$" label="common.field.updateBy" />,
                 <TextField key="createBy" source="createBy$" label="common.field.createBy" />,
                 <DateField key="createTime" source="createTime" label="common.field.createTime" showTime />,
                 <BooleanField key="statusBool" source="statusBool" label="common.field.status" sortable={false} />,
@@ -253,8 +255,9 @@
                     preferenceKey='warehouseAreasItem'
                     bulkActionButtons={false}
                     rowClick={(id, resource, record) => false}
-                    omit={['prodTime','unit','platOrderCode','trackCode','id', 'createTime', 'memo', 'areaId', 'brand', 'createBy$',
-                         'weight', 'matnrId', 'batch', 'shipperId', 'splrId', 'platWorkCode', 'projectCode','statusBool']}
+                    omit={['prodTime','platOrderCode','id', 'createTime', 'memo', 'areaId', 'brand', 
+                         'weight', 'splrId', 'projectCode','statusBool', 'extendFields.[priceUnitId]', 'isptResult$', 'extendFields.[inStockType]',
+                         'matnrId', 'trackCode', 'workQty', 'batch', 'shipperId', 'isptResult', 'createBy$', 'createTime', 'extendFields.[baseUnitId]']}
                 >
                     {columns.map((column) => column)}
                 </StyledDatagrid>}

--
Gitblit v1.9.1